The Right Beanie for Your Workout
Beanies are not just fashion statements; they're practical accessories for gym-goers. Look for lightweight, breathable materials that wick away moisture while keeping your hair in place. Opt for slouchy beanies for a laid-back punk vibe or tighter fits for a sleek, streamlined look.

Styling Tips for Punk Hair with Beanies
To rock a punk hairstyle with a beanie, focus on creating texture and volume at the crown before donning your hat. Use texturizing sprays or volumizing powders to give your hair lift, ensuring the beanie doesn't flatten your style. Experiment with exposing some of your punk hairstyle in the front or sides to showcase your edgy look.

FAQ
How can I prevent my beanie from slipping during workouts?
Opt for beanies with elastic bands or those made from non-slip materials. Tightening your beanie slightly above the nape of your neck can also help secure it in place.
Can I still rock a punk hairstyle if I have short hair?
Absolutely! Punk hairstyles for short hair can include textured pixie cuts, undercuts, or dyed sections. These styles pair well with beanies and offer a low-maintenance option for gym enthusiasts.
